🛡️ How Scanning Works
- Search for an IP or asset. If you want fresh results, click the Scan button on the asset details page.
- Scan Queuing: When you request a scan, the IP is added to our scanning queue. You will see a confirmation message when the scan is queued.
- Scan Frequency: Each IP can only be scanned once every 24 hours to ensure fair usage and up-to-date results.
- Scan Process: Our backend will perform port scans, service detection, vulnerability checks, and screenshots (where possible). This may take a few minutes.
- Results Update: Once scanning is complete, the results will be updated automatically. Refresh the asset page to see the latest findings.
Note: If you try to scan an IP that was scanned recently, you will have to wait until the 24-hour period has passed before you can scan it again. This helps us manage resources and prevent abuse.
